4. Popular Aldi Breakfast Cereal Brands

Aldi carries several popular private label brands known for their quality and taste. Some of the most popular brands include:

  • Millville: Known for its wide range of cereals, including granola and frosted flakes.
  • Simply Nature: Offers organic options, focusing on natural ingredients and healthy choices.
  • Specially Selected: This brand features gourmet cereals that appeal to a more sophisticated palate.
